Here are the states who are failing LGBTI homeless youth

With approximately 40% of homeless youth in the United States identifying as LGBT+, state governments are not taking this number into account when planning for child welfare, juvenile justice, and homelessness systems.

19 Senators ask Trump administration why it’s erasing LGBTQ people

The Senators sent a letter to the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) to urge them to collect data on LGBTQ people.  They were prompted to do so in March after a draft copy of the National Survey of Older Americans Act Participants was altered to remove a question asking if survey participants identify as LGBT+.

Supreme Court Rejects Challenge to ‘Gay Conversion’ Therapy Ban

The U.S. Supreme Court left unchanged California’s ban on therapy intended to turn people under the age of 19 straight.  This was in response to a Christian minister’s challenge to the law claiming it violated his “religious freedom”.
